     65 /*
     66  * Support for the SiS 85c503 PCI-ISA bridge interrupt controller.
     67  */
     68 
     69 #include <sys/param.h>
     70 #include <sys/systm.h>
     71 #include <sys/device.h>
     72 
     73 #include <machine/intr.h>
     74 #include <machine/bus.h>
     75 
     76 #include <dev/pci/pcivar.h>
     77 #include <dev/pci/pcireg.h>
     78 #include <dev/pci/pcidevs.h>
     79 
     80 #include <i386/pci/pci_intr_fixup.h>
     81 #include <i386/pci/sis85c503reg.h>
     82 #include <i386/pci/piixvar.h>
     83 
     84 int	sis85c503_getclink __P((pciintr_icu_handle_t, int, int *));
     85 int	sis85c503_get_intr __P((pciintr_icu_handle_t, int, int *));
     86 int	sis85c503_set_intr __P((pciintr_icu_handle_t, int, int));
     87 
     88 const struct pciintr_icu sis85c503_pci_icu = {
     89 	sis85c503_getclink,
     90 	sis85c503_get_intr,
     91 	sis85c503_set_intr,
     92 	piix_get_trigger,
     93 	piix_set_trigger,
     94 };
     95 
     96 int
     97 sis85c503_init(pc, iot, tag, ptagp, phandp)
     98 	pci_chipset_tag_t pc;
     99 	bus_space_tag_t iot;
    100 	pcitag_t tag;
    101 	pciintr_icu_tag_t *ptagp;
    102 	pciintr_icu_handle_t *phandp;
    103 {
    104 
    105 	if (piix_init(pc, iot, tag, ptagp, phandp) == 0) {
    106 		*ptagp = &sis85c503_pci_icu;
    107 		return (0);
    108 	}
    109 
    110 	return (1);
    111 }
    112 
    113 int
    114 sis85c503_getclink(v, link, clinkp)
    115 	pciintr_icu_handle_t v;
    116 	int link, *clinkp;
    117 {
    118 
    119 	/* Pattern 1: simple. */
    120 	if (link >= 1 && link <= 4) {
    121 		*clinkp = S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_REGSTART + link - 1;
    122 		return (0);
    123 	}
    124 
    125 	/* Pattern 2: configuration register offset */
    126 	if (link >= S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_REGSTART &&
    127 	    link <= S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_REGEND) {
    128 		*clinkp = link;
    129 		return (0);
    130 	}
    131 
    132 	return (1);
    133 }
    134 
    135 int
    136 sis85c503_get_intr(v, clink, irqp)
    137 	pciintr_icu_handle_t v;
    138 	int clink, *irqp;
    139 {
    140 	struct piix_handle *ph = v;
    141 	pcireg_t reg;
    142 
    143 	if (SIS85C503_LEGAL_LINK(clink) == 0)
    144 		return (1);
    145 
    146 	reg = pci_conf_read(ph->ph_pc, ph->ph_tag,
    147 	    S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_REGOFS(clink));
    148 	reg = S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_REG(reg, clink);
    149 
    150 	if (reg & S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_ROUTE_DISABLE)
    151 		*irqp = 0xff;
    152 	else
    153 		*irqp = reg & S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_INTR_MASK;
    154 
    155 	return (0);
    156 }
    157 
    158 int
    159 sis85c503_set_intr(v, clink, irq)
    160 	pciintr_icu_handle_t v;
    161 	int clink, irq;
    162 {
    163 	struct piix_handle *ph = v;
    164 	int shift;
    165 	pcireg_t reg;
    166 
    167 	if (SIS85C503_LEGAL_LINK(clink) == 0 || SIS85C503_LEGAL_IRQ(irq) == 0)
    168 		return (1);
    169 
    170 	reg = pci_conf_read(ph->ph_pc, ph->ph_tag,
    171 	    S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_REGOFS(clink));
    172 	shift = S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_SHIFT(clink);
    173 	reg &= ~((S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_ROUTE_DISABLE |
    174 	    S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_INTR_MASK) << shift);
    175 	reg |= (irq << shift);
    176 	pci_conf_write(ph->ph_pc, ph->ph_tag, SIS85C503_CFG_PIRQ_REGOFS(clink),
    177 	    reg);
    178 
    179 	return (0);
